    Airfield facts & what can operate

    Belfast International AirportEdinburgh Airport
    Code EGAA / BFS EGPH / EDI
    Longest hard runway 9,121 ft 8,392 ft
    Surface Asphalt Asphalt
    Field elevation 268 ft 135 ft

    Which aircraft can use both airfields

    All 21 aircraft we quote for Belfast to Edinburgh can use both airfields and fly the route non-stop. Belfast International Airport has 9,121 ft and Edinburgh Airport 8,392 ft, both comfortably beyond the 6,000 ft the largest types here need, so field length is not what decides the aircraft on this route — cabin size and range are.
